The new Jawa 350 has been updated for 2024 and its prices now begin at Rs. 1.99 lakh, ex-showroom, Delhi.
The bike is available in three new colours – Obsidian Black, Deep Forest, and grey. The Jawa 350 Chrome series gets a new white colour that looks rather fetching. It joins the maroon, black, and Mystique Orange colours in the Chrome series portfolio.
Jawa has also introduced alloy wheels as an option, which costs Rs. 10,000 more than the version with the wire-spoke wheels. The alloy wheels-equipped variant comes with tubeless tyres. That makes it easier to fix punctures as opposed to the tube-type tyres on the wire-spoke variants where one has to unmount the wheel, remove the tube, and fix it.
The Jawa 350 is powered by a 334cc, single-cylinder, liquid-cooled engine that makes 22.5bhp at 7,000rpm and 28.1Nm at 5,000rpm and is paired with a six-speed gearbox. This engine is the same unit as the one you see in the Jawa Perak but is in a lower state of tune and makes lesser power. Jawa says that the engine is tuned to offer strong low- and mid-range performance, which should make it more tractable than the Perak. That in turn will make it a pretty relaxed commuter in the city as well.
The Jawa 350 employs a double cradle frame that is suspended by a 35mm, telescopic fork and twin shock absorbers with preload adjustability. It has a longer wheelbase than that of the Jawa Standard at 1,449mm. That should give it better straight-line stability as well as a planted feel in the corners. The bike also gets a wider, 130-section rear tyre and 100-section front tyre.
Braking duties are carried out by a 280mm disc at the front and a 240mm disc at the rear and dual-channel ABS comes as standard. The Jawa 350 weighs 194kg and offers a class-leading 178mm of ground clearance.
As for the design, it looks neat, with swooping fenders, teardrop-shaped tank, and a chunky side panel. The bike looks very good and is reminiscent of the original bike’s design.
The Jawa 350 will go up against the Royal Enfield Classic 350 and the Honda CB350. Both of these motorcycles have single-cylinder, air-cooled engines and make less power than the Jawa 350’s engine.

It's been 1 year since I bought it. I have covered over 23k km and traveled 4 states in the south in a year. Please think again before you buy it. The pros are simple. Top in performance and breaking, eye-catching looks, you would love it when you ride at high rpm, but all these at what cost? Now the real things you need to face are first the low mileage, like 22 in the city and 27 on the highway. worst mileage in the segment. 2nd, you will listen chain and engine sound more than the exhaust. 3rd, the paint quality is worse. 4th, the chain set life is 12k to max 15k km again, the worst thing you can have in any bike. 5th, the service experience, it's the worst service, and the average price per service is 4 to 5k min sure. 6th, the sensors are too many in it, and their life is also very less, which is very expensive. 7th after-market spare parts availability is a joke in Jawa 8th. For the stock seat, you can drive max an hour after it, you will surely get back pain. The 9th its resale value is very less. 10 th the cold start, the bike won't start in winters or any season like it needs a cold start for atleast 5mins and it's not like you can instantly start ur bike and go it needs time to breath not only in morning but every time you stop ur bike and you will get irritated by it. Please think again before you buy it. It's an extraordinary bike, but at a very expensive cost.
